Output 43283e6662683e2c64693ef909bcbede1f73d59d6761317cabd4c18c53a28578:1

value
66079295
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bf2a6155e25610d07d3844b54438c155d256333 OP_EQUALVERIFY OP_CHECKSIG
address
LWXL4LfPL77KJ7vCZwWFrqzso1TGEXEF4f
transaction
43283e6662683e2c64693ef909bcbede1f73d59d6761317cabd4c18c53a28578
spent
true